just went from mandrake 7.1 to 7.2 on my laptop which ran great with 7.1. can't figure out how or if there are desktop themes for 7.2 and also i have a crystal soundcard that 7.1 detected but will not on 7.2. anyone have any ideas or should i just go back to 7.1

Themes in KDE 2.0 is not as easy as in KDE 1.x, but you can find some (well hidden) tips at http://kde.themes.org

KDE 2.1 (beta) has, as far as I know, a better Theme Manager. I haven't installed the 2.1-beta on my Mandrake 7.2 yet, since I got problems installing the 2.0.1 RPMs.
